35、数据库技术综合解析:从基础到高级应用
数据库技术综合解析:从基础到高级应用
1. 数据访问设计与技术
1.1 数据访问架构
数据访问设计涵盖多个关键方面,其架构主要包含客户端、数据存储和中间层。客户端技术包括各种客户端库,如 SQLNCLI 等,它在数据访问中扮演重要角色。数据存储方面,有不同的数据库系统,如 OLTP 和 OLAP,它们各有特点,适用于不同的业务场景。中间层则涉及各种应用程序和服务,用于协调客户端和数据存储之间的交互。
1.2 数据访问技术
常见的数据访问技术包括 ActiveX Data Objects (ADO)、ADO.NET、ADOMD.NET 等。其中,ADO.NET 具有缓存功能,可通过以下步骤进行设置: 1. 配置连接字符串,设置相关属性,如 ConnectionString 、 ConnectTimeout 等。 2. 使用 ConnectionSettings 类进行连接设置。 3. 利用 DataSet 或 DataReader 对象进行数据操作。
示例代码如下:
using System.Data.SqlClient;
// 创建连接字符串
string connectionString = "Data Source=YOUR_SERVER;Initial Catalog=YOUR_DATABASE;User ID=YOUR_USER;Password=YOUR_PASS